Volatility and Return to Player (RTP) – Understanding the Odds
Two critical concepts for any player engaging with these types of games are volatility and Return to Player (RTP). Volatility refers to the risk associated with a particular game. High volatility games offer the potential for large payouts but occur less frequently, while low volatility games provide more frequent, smaller wins. RTP, expressed as a percentage, represents the average amount of wagered money that a game is expected to return to players over a prolonged period. A higher RTP generally indicates a more favorable game for the player. Before diving into a game, it’s wise to research its volatility and RTP to understand the inherent risks and potential rewards.
